OA Classic Motors was founded on a tradition of excellence in automotive craftsmanship. The story begins in Extremadura, Spain, where my grandfather worked as a Mercedes-Benz dealer and my uncle built a reputation as a highly skilled mechanic. Known for his precision and professionalism, he believed in preserving authenticity by restoring original parts whenever possible, a philosophy that continues to inspire our work today.
That early exposure to German engineering, particularly Mercedes-Benz, instilled in me a lifelong appreciation for timeless automobiles. After refining my skills in London with Chelsea Cars, a respected name in the classic car world, my passion for European classics grew into expertise.
Together with my wife, Laura Burgos, we began acquiring and restoring classic cars for our own private collection. What started as a shared passion soon evolved into OA Classic Motors. A workshop dedicated to honoring automotive heritage. Over the years, we have meticulously restored numerous Mercedes-Benz icons, including the w113 280SL and w121 190SL, always with an unwavering attention to detail.
OA Classic Motors continues this legacy, combining heritage, skill, and dedication to offer discerning collectors a trusted partner in the preservation and enjoyment of classic automobiles
— Ousama Ait Aftis, Founder
